College of the Canyons sophomore quarterback Devon Dunn has been named the Southern California Football Association (SCFA) Northern League Co-Offensive Player of the Week based on his performance vs. Santa Ana College in week three.
Dunn, who received the same honor after his week one performance vs. Mt. SAC, will share his most recent award with Cerritos College wide receiver De’Jai Whitaker.
The COC signal caller finished last week’s game vs. Santa Ana 26-of-43 for 262 passing yards, while also rushing for 96 yards and three touchdowns on 14 carries.
Those totals also included a 29-yard game-winning run late in the fourth quarter that put the Cougars ahead for good.
Dunn has helped lead Canyons to its first 3-0 start since the 2008 season.
Additionally, the Cougars are currently the No. 5 ranked team in the state acording to the most recent statewide coaches poll released on Monday.
COC will begin its conference schedule on the road vs. Pasadena City College at 6 p.m. Saturday, Sept. 26
